Elon Musk has lost his lawsuit against Sam Altman and OpenAI

On May 18, 2026, a federal judge dismissed Elon Musk's lawsuit against Sam Altman and OpenAI. Musk had filed the suit in 2024, claiming that OpenAI violated its original nonprofit charter by becoming a for-profit entity and partnering with Microsoft. The court ruled that OpenAI's shift to a capped-profit model did not breach any binding agreements, as the original mission statement was not a legally enforceable contract. The judge also rejected antitrust allegations, stating that the Microsoft partnership did not constitute illegal monopolization. This decision allows OpenAI to continue its current structure without legal hindrance from Musk's claims. The case was dismissed with prejudice, meaning it cannot be refiled.
